Insert Material Quality

Choosing the right material for your noise-canceling window inserts is essential for effective sound insulation.

  • Density Matters: Higher density materials generally absorb sound better because they dampen vibrations.
  • Soundproofing Ratings: Check for materials with high Noise Reduction Coefficient (NRC) scores, close to 1.0, which indicate strong sound reduction abilities.
  • Durability: Opt for high-quality materials that resist environmental wear and tear, guaranteeing long-term effectiveness.
  • Multi-layered Construction: Inserts with multiple layers create air gaps that act as barriers, improving sound isolation considerably.
  • Safety Compliance: Confirm the materials meet safety standards, such as being flame retardant and non-toxic, to protect your home environment.

Noise Reduction Effectiveness

Effective noise reduction is essential for creating a peaceful living environment, especially in urban areas or near loud machinery. When choosing noise-canceling window inserts, consider the Sound Transmission Class (STC) rating. Higher ratings indicate better noise attenuation.

Key factors include:

  • Material Layers: Inserts with multiple layers and air gaps disrupt sound waves effectively.
  • Dense Materials: High-density foam or specially formulated glass absorbs or reflects sound energy, enhancing soundproofing.
  • Sealing: Proper sealing around window frames is critical. Even small gaps can reduce performance considerably.

In well-installed inserts, studies demonstrate they can achieve 70-90% noise reduction, making them ideal for sound-sensitive environments. Always prioritize quality and installation to maximize effectiveness.

Thermal Insulation Properties

When choosing noise-canceling window inserts, it’s important to reflect on their thermal insulation properties. These inserts can greatly reduce heat transfer, keeping your home cooler in the summer and warmer in the winter. A good insert helps regulate temperature and can lower energy costs by minimizing the need for heating and cooling systems.

The effective thermal insulation comes from their multi-layer construction, often featuring air gaps. These air gaps inhibit heat conduction, blocking drafts and maintaining a consistent indoor temperature. As a result, enhanced insulation contributes to energy efficiency in your home. You’ll notice reduced energy bills as the desired indoor temperatures are retained with less energy expenditure, making these inserts a smart investment for comfort and savings.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Do Noise Cancelling Window Inserts Work?

Noise cancelling window inserts work by creating an additional barrier between outdoor noise and your indoor space. These inserts are typically made from multi-layer glass or acrylic, which helps absorb sound waves. The air gap between the original window and the insert enhances insulation, further reducing noise. When installed correctly, they can lower decibel levels notably, often by 25 decibels or more, making your home quieter and more comfortable.

What Materials Are Noise Cancelling Window Inserts Made Of?

Noise-cancelling window inserts are typically made from materials like acrylic, polycarbonate, or glass. Each material offers different benefits; for instance, acrylic is lightweight and shatter-resistant, while glass is more durable and offers better soundproofing. Most inserts feature an air gap between the panels, which helps block sound waves. Prices generally range from $25 to $100 per insert, depending on size and material. These window inserts effectively reduce outside noise, enhancing your living environment.

Do Window Inserts Affect Natural Light?

Window inserts can act like filters, slightly reducing natural light while enhancing sound insulation. The thickness and material of the inserts often determine this effect. Generally, double or triple-pane inserts offer better soundproofing but may diminish light transmission by up to 10-20%. If you prioritize noise reduction, consider transparent options like acrylic. They minimize light loss while still providing a barrier against unwanted sounds, ensuring your space remains bright and serene.

Are Noise Cancelling Window Inserts Energy Efficient?

Yes, noise cancelling window inserts are energy efficient. They help reduce heat loss in winter and heat gain in summer, improving your home’s insulation. When properly installed, these inserts can lower energy bills by 10-25%. They work by trapping air between the window and the insert, which acts as an insulating barrier. Additionally, they provide added comfort by keeping indoor temperatures stable, making your living space more pleasant year-round.
